Atty. Michael Poa, VP Sara Duterte’s Former Spokesman, Speaks on Filing Entry as Co-Counsel
SARA DUTERTE’S FORMER SPOKESMAN – Attorney Michael Poa joined the legal team of the Vice President in challenging an impeachment case against her before the Supreme Court.
An impeach trial against Vice Pres. Sara Duterte is expected to commence in the next few months after the House of Representatives approved her impeachment. Two-thirds of the lawmakers in the lower chamber signed the impeachment of Duterte.

Previously, Senate Pres. Chiz Escudero has issued a proposed timeline for Vice Pres. Sara Duterte’s impeachment trial. The tentative date for the commencement of the trial is on July 30. The Senate President said that the proposed timetable still needs the nod of the lawmakers.

Vice Pres. Sara Duterte has previously filed a petition before the Supreme Court challenging the constitutionality of the 4th impeachment case filed against her. The Vice President appealed to the high court to declare it null based on the grounds provided in the petition.

Former Pres. Rodrigo Roa Duterte is one of the lawyers who signed Vice Pres. Sara Duterte’s petition filed before the Supreme Court. The Vice President had a seven-member legal team. Recently, Vice Pres. Sara Duterte’s former spokesman, Attorney Michael Poa, filed his entry of appearance as co-counsel for the Vice President.

Based on a report on PhilStar, Atty. Michael Poa’s inclusion to the legal team of the Vice President was confirmed by the Office of the Spokesperson of the Supreme Court. Vice Pres. Sara Duterte’s former spokesman released a statement regarding his decision to serve as counsel of his former boss.
“In my view, the petition filed before the Supreme Court also raises constitutional questions/concerns that need to be addressed,” Poa said.
Based on the report, Duterte and Poa have first worked together in the Department of Education when she was the DepEd secretary. He worked as the chief of staff of the then-education secretary. When Duterte resigned from being the DepEd secretary, Poa also left the helm of the education department.
Atty. Michael Poa became the spokesman of Vice Pres. Sara Duterte in the Office of the Vice President (OVP) after his resignation as her chief of staff in DepEd. However, Vice Pres. Sara Duterte’s former spokesman Michael Poa left the post shortly after the House of Representatives started scrutinizing the OVP.
